l.. Forded herewith are prototypes of the IN-3X, fixed
frequency reference oscillator, and. the IN-U, variable frequency
audio oscillator. The 15-3X %%presents the final prototype for
evaluation prior to fabrication of the complete order. The IN-1X
is an electrical prototype only since certain agreed upx changes
in packaging will be made Vban the unit is returzaed.
2. Although the circuit study of the INr3X has been completed,
further production of this oscillator will Upend on the quality of
the unijunction transistors now on order. The stand-off ratios and
bass resistance characteristics of these transistors have been speci-
fied, in accordance with our sturdy, to insure an accuracy of ? 2%
over the specified temperature range. Reliability checks will be
run on these transistors when received.
3. In regard to the IN-1X# a now layout will be mad* in accord-
ance with our agreeaent. It is for this reason that the present unit
is considered an electrical prototype only. The relocation of some
controls sad battery storage will facilitate a simplified hook-up and
neater yppearance. A certain minims space must be allowed for the
frequency determining capacitors as these will vary according to the
partl=lw unijunetion transistor used.
4. Schematics, parts lists, and a calibration curve are in-
cluded. A few control markings have been made in order to avoid
ambiguity. Please specify all additional marking required.

1. Power Source: Z cell (Burgess) I(Mercury cell( BM-5012R
2. Battery Polarity: c re ; See paragraph 4.2
3. Output Impedance: 2000 ohms approximately
4. Stability: 1 part in 10,000 over temperature range
5. Output Millivolts: 2K - 35 my (earphone)
5K to 100K - 100 my (recorder)
6. Temperature range: -40? to ~ 40? C
7. Warm-up Time: 45 seconds
8. Local Control: Power - SW1 (on-off)
Output Control - SW2 (push button)
9. Remote Control: Remote position not furnished
Power switch (on-off)
Output switch (push)
Remote battery
